The Delhi Metro journey from Khan Market to Patel Nagar involves an interchange at Central Secretariat — from the Purple Line to the Yellow Line. Total distance is 10 km with an estimated travel time of 19 minutes across 9 stations.
This route on the Delhi Metro runs along the Purple Line, with an interchange to the Yellow Line at Central Secretariat. Khan Market station has been operational since 2015. Patel Nagar station opened in 2005.
